首页 > TAG信息列表 > ALP

CodeForces-940F Machine Learning

Machine Learning 询问一个区间,求区间内数的桶的 MEX,还有单点修改 带修莫队 直接离线用带修莫队,然后维护一个桶的桶,每次询问答案的时候直接找 MEX 就行了 一开始想复杂了,一直想维护 MEX 的值,然后用了一个 set 去维护,但是每次修改的时候都会乘上一个 logn 级别,导致超时 看了答案后,

无重复字符的最长子串(Java)

力扣第三题:,链接:力扣 题目:给定一个字符串 s ,请你找出其中不含有重复字符的 最长子串 的长度。 示例一 输入: s = "abcabcbb" 输出: 3 解释: 因为无重复字符的最长子串是 "abc",所以其长度为 3。 示例二 输入: s = "bbbbb" 输出: 1 解释: 因为无重复字符的最长子串是 "b",所以其长

cesium 加载科技感

cesium 加载模型上边的呼吸感 // 设置透明度 var alp = 1; var num = 0; 在model里边添加这个color参数 color:new Cesium.CallbackProperty(function () { if ((num % 2) === 0){

Adversarial Logit Pairing_CSDN

Adversarial Logit Pairing Adversarial Logit Pairing we introduce enhanced defenses using a technique we call logit pairing, a method that encourages logits for pairs of examples to be similar. 本文提出了一种logit pairing方法做防御。 0. Recall 0.1 Adversa

leetcode刷题---字符串---学生出勤记录Ⅰ

给定一个字符串来代表一个学生的出勤记录,这个记录仅包含以下三个字符: 'A' : Absent,缺勤 'L' : Late,迟到 'P' : Present,到场 如果一个学生的出勤记录中不超过一个’A’(缺勤)并且不超过两个连续的’L’(迟到),那么这个学生会被奖赏。 你需要根据这个学生的出勤记录判断他是否

leetcode767. 重构字符串

      记录上一个写入的字母,找除了这个字母以外的出现次数最多的字母插入。 class Solution { public: string reorganizeString(string S) { int alp[26]; int i; for(i=0;i<26;i++){ alp[i]=0; } for(i=0;i<S.le

Python字符串常用函数详解

字符串相关操作大致总结以下9个部分,包括常用字符集合、大小写转换、判断字符元素类型、字符填充、字符串搜索、字符串替换、字符串添加、字符串修剪以及字符串分割。'字符串相关函数''1.字符串常量集合'import stringprint(string.ascii_uppercase) #大写字母print(string.ascii_l

【字符串】767. 重构字符串

题目:     解答: 优先队列,根据字母数量进行排序。 (1)记录每个字母在字符串中的数量(哈希表); (2)根据字母数量降序排序(插入优先队列,以字母数量较大优先级较高,类似于大顶堆) (3)若队列顶部字母的数量大于一半则无法构造,直接返回空字符串(奇偶有别) (4)按照字母数量降序顺序,当队列不空时,依次按照

Python活力练习Day11

Day11:输入一行字符,分别统计出其中的英文字母,空格,数字以及其他字符的个数 # 还有一个直接可以判断字符或者数字的方法:s.isalnum() 1 def fun(): 2 ''' 3 s:输入的字符串 4 alp:字母长度 5 num:数字长度 6 spa:空白字符长度(包括'\n','\t') 7 othe

Codeforces 520A

#include <stdio.h> #include <string.h> #include <stdbool.h> int main() { int n; scanf("%d", &n); char line[120]; scanf("%s", line); int alp[30]; int Count=0; memset(alp, 0, sizeof(alp)); bool Put=true;

520A

#include <stdio.h>#include <string.h>#include <stdbool.h> int main(){ int n; scanf("%d", &n); char line[120]; scanf("%s", line); int alp[30]; int Count=0; memset(alp, 0, sizeof(alp)); bool Put=true; if(n<26) {

python每天1道面试题(2)--删除特定字符

"""题目2:输入两个字符串,从第一字符串中删除第二个字符串中所有的字符。例如,输入”They are students.”和”aeiou”,则删除之后的第一个字符串变成”Thy r stdnts.”。解题思路: 遍历第二个字符串中所有的字符,将第一字符串中包含的这个字符全部用''替换"""def rm_alp(str, alphabe